** Climate refers to the long-term atmospheric conditions in a particular region, including temperature, humidity, cloudiness, wind, precipitation, and other meteorological elements that influence the environment and living organisms. **CONTENT:** ### Overview Climate is a vital component of the Earth's system, shaping the planet's ecosystems, weather patterns, and natural resources. It is a complex and dynamic phenomenon that has been studied extensively by scientists, policymakers, and the general public. Understanding climate is essential for predicting weather events, mitigating the effects of climate change, and conserving natural resources. Climate plays a crucial role in determining the distribution and abundance of plants and animals, as well as human settlements and economic activities. Climate is often confused with weather, but they are distinct concepts. Weather refers to short-term atmospheric conditions, such as temperature, humidity, and precipitation, while climate encompasses long-term patterns and trends. Climate is influenced by various factors, including latitude, altitude, ocean currents, and atmospheric circulation patterns. These factors interact to create different climate zones, each with its unique characteristics and ecosystems. Climate has a profound impact on human societies, economies, and ecosystems. It affects agriculture, water resources, energy production, and human health. Climate change, in particular, poses significant threats to global food security, economic stability, and human well-being. ** The climate is the long-term average atmospheric condition of a particular region, encompassing temperature, humidity, cloudiness, wind, precipitation, and other meteorological elements that influence the Earth's surface. **CONTENT:** ### Overview The climate is a vital component of the Earth's system, playing a crucial role in shaping the planet's ecosystems, weather patterns, and human societies. It is a complex and dynamic entity that has evolved over millions of years, influenced by various natural and anthropogenic factors. The climate is not a static entity, but rather a constantly changing system that responds to changes in the Earth's orbit, volcanic eruptions, and human activities such as deforestation, pollution, and greenhouse gas emissions. The climate is often characterized by its temperature, precipitation, and seasonal patterns, which vary significantly across different regions and latitudes. For example, tropical regions near the equator experience high temperatures and high levels of precipitation, while polar regions experience low temperatures and low levels of precipitation. The climate also plays a critical role in shaping the Earth's ecosystems, influencing the distribution and abundance of plants and animals, and impacting human health, agriculture, and infrastructure. ### History/Background The concept of climate has been studied and documented by scientists and philosophers for centuries. Ancient Greek philosophers such as Aristotle and Epicurus recognized the importance of climate in shaping human societies and ecosystems. In the 19th century, scientists such as Svante Arrhenius and Joseph Fourier began to study the Earth's energy balance and the role of greenhouse gases in shaping the climate. The development of modern climate science accelerated in the 20th century with the establishment of the Intergovernmental Panel on Climate Change (IPCC) in 1988.
